Safety First: Securing Your Indoor Setup
Indoor bounce house setup requires different safety considerations than outdoor installations. Since you can’t stake a bounce house to the ground inside of your home’s basement or garage, you are going to want to use weighted anchors. Vinyl sandbags are an ideal choice for accomplishing this task, as they are heavy, yet flexible with regard to how they sit.
Professional rental companies understand these requirements. If you’re placing your indoor bounce house in the garage, on a hardwood floor, or on the hard floor of a gymnasium or auditorium, though, you’ll need a layer underneath – usually in the form of a tarp. Make sure the tarp is large enough to cover the bottom of your bounce house and that it’s durable enough to protect the bottom of the bounce house from the surface it’s resting on.
Preparing Your Space for Success
Converting your garage or basement into a party venue requires some preparation. Start by clearing the area completely and ensuring adequate ventilation. First of all, if you’re placing the bounce house in a playroom, you’ve got to make sure the ceilings are high enough to accommodate the bounce house of your choosing. You’ve also got to make sure that the room is big enough to accommodate space for the sandbag anchors.
Consider the flooring carefully. Hard surfaces need protective tarps, while ensuring the space is level and free from obstacles. Lighting is another important factor – make sure the area is well-lit for both safety and photography opportunities.
